情境相依之總要素投入效率分析法,結合了情境相依DEA分析(Context-dependent DEA)與總要素投入效率指標(Total-factor input efficiency)。它同時包含了兩者的優點,因此我們可以在分析不同的總要素投入效率的同時,將決策單位(DMUs)分類到不同的效率層級,來進行效率評估。為了展示如何應用此方法,我們採用了25家分別來自臺灣、南韓、日本及中國的顯示器製造商於2010年至2014年的資料,我們分別使用3種效率指標來做情境相依之DEA分層分析,其包含:整體技術效率、總資產的總要素投入效率及總研發支出的總要素投入效率。結果顯示,在採用不同的效率指標下,各個決策單位所位於的層級也有所不同。
The context-dependent total-factor input efficiency is an approach combing context-dependent DEA and the concept of total-factor input efficiency. It incorporates the advantages of both context-dependent DEA and total-factor input efficiency such that we can evaluate the DMUs by dividing them into specific levels and realize the disaggregate input efficiency. To illustrate this approach, we use the data of 25 manufacturers of display industry from Taiwan, Korea, Japan, and China, for the period from 2010 to 2014. The results show that the level rankings are different under the three measurements: overall technical efficiency (OTE), total-factor input efficiency (TFIE) of total assets, and total-factor input efficiency (TFIE) of R&D expenses.
